Published: Mon, May 19, 2008 - 2:24 pm
UNDATED, Ala. (AP) - Gasoline has hit yet another record high,
both in Alabama and nationally. According to AAA's Daily Fuel Gauge
Report, Alabama's average for a gallon of regular unleaded hit
$3.70 today while the national average climbed to $3.79.
According to AAA's survey of Alabama's metro areas, the lowest
gas prices were found in Birmingham, which averages $3.69 per
gallon of regular. Mobile and Huntsville were tied for the highest
average price for regular at $3.72 a gallon.
Drivers in parts of California, Alaska, Connecticut and Chicago
are paying $4 or more for a gallon of regular unleaded.
